"教学设施管理系统 SQL Sever2005+VC++"是一个基于Visual C++的软件项目,主要利用了MFC(Microsoft Foundation Classes)库进行界面开发,并通过ADO(ActiveX Data Objects)实现了与SQL Server 2005数据库的交互。在这个系统中,开发者深入运用了数据库编程技术,旨在为教学设施的管理和调度提供便捷的工具。 让我们来看看MFC编程。MFC是微软提供的一个C++类库,它封装了Windows API,使得开发者能够更高效地构建Windows应用程序。在本项目中,MFC被用来创建用户界面,包括窗口、控件、菜单、对话框等元素,简化了UI的设计和事件处理。通过MFC,开发者可以快速构建出符合Windows标准的图形用户界面。 接着,我们讨论ADO数据库连接。ADO是微软的数据库访问技术,它允许程序通过OLE DB接口访问各种数据源,包括SQL Server。在本系统中,开发者使用ADO来建立与SQL Server 2005的连接,执行SQL查询,插入、更新和删除数据。通过ADO,开发者无需关心底层数据库的具体实现,只需要编写简单的代码就能完成复杂的数据库操作。 SQL Server 2005是微软的一款关系型数据库管理系统,广泛应用于企业级的数据存储和管理。在教学设施管理系统中,SQL Server 2005用于存储教学设施的相关信息,如设施类型、数量、状态、预定记录等。开发者利用SQL语言设计和管理数据库表结构,确保数据的一致性和完整性。 在VC++中进行数据库编程,通常需要结合使用MFC的CDaoDatabase和CDaoRecordset类,或者ADO的CDatabase和CRecordset类。这些类提供了封装好的方法,方便操作数据库。例如,通过Open方法连接数据库,ExecuteSQL或OpenRecordset方法执行查询,而Update或Delete方法则用于修改或删除数据。 关于压缩包中的“软件源代码”,这通常包含了项目的全部源文件,包括头文件(.h)、源文件(.cpp)、资源文件(.rc)等。开发者可以通过查看这些源代码,了解如何将MFC、ADO和SQL Server 2005结合,实现特定功能。对于初学者来说,这是一个极好的学习资源,能够帮助他们理解数据库驱动的Windows应用程序开发流程。 总结,这个项目综合运用了MFC、ADO和SQL Server 2005的技术,展示了如何使用VC++进行数据库编程,构建一个实用的教学设施管理系统。对于想要提升自己在这些领域技能的开发者,这个项目无疑是一个宝贵的实践案例。通过深入研究源代码,不仅可以学习到具体的编程技巧,还能加深对软件工程整体流程的理解。
- 1
- 粉丝: 2
- 资源: 2
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 【年度培训】培训效果评估报告(修改版)行政人事CLUB.doc
- 【年度培训】培训计划表行政人事CLUB.doc
- 【年度培训】公司员工培训总结报告行政人事CLUB.doc
- 【年度培训】年度培训计划及预算方案行政人事CLUB.doc
- 【年度培训】年度培训总结模板(内附表格,拿来即用)行政人事CLUB.doc
- 【年度培训】2023年度公司培训计划方案行政人事CLUB.doc
- 【年度培训】公司年度培训工作计划(完整版)行政人事CLUB.doc
- 【年度培训】【企业培训师】年度培训工作总结报告行政人事CLUB.doc
- 【年度培训】培训需求调查行政人事CLUB.pptx
- 【年度培训】DP152企业培训体系建设需求分析PPT行政人事CLUB.pptx
- 【年度培训】人力资源员工培训管理系统(完美版)行政人事CLUB.xlsx
- 【年度培训】2023年全年培训计划的副本行政人事CLUB.pptx
- 探索大规模语言模型在上下文学习中的决策边界机制
- 【年度培训】培训需求分析及评估行政人事CLUB.ppt
- 【年度培训】培训效果评估问卷行政人事CLUB.xlsx
- 【年度培训】培训员工跟踪表行政人事CLUB.xlsx
- 1
- 2
前往页